Marketing with Articles
Article marketing is a great online tool for affiliate businesses. Marketers have the opportunity to write articles that advertise the products or services they promote. Merchants benefit from the efforts of every marketer involved in their program.
Marketing with articles gives affiliate marketers the opportunity to pre-sell products and services sold by the merchant. The more familiar the marketer is with the products, the more they will sell simply because they become considered an expert on the topic. Earning potential is limitless and article marketing is an inexpensive marketing tool.
Marketers aren't always writers themselves. They often hire a writing service to provide quality content. This technique allows them to hire writers that can highlight different aspects of their business or products. It is up to the marketer to decide how many articles to publish each month.
Once articles are written and approved, the marketer may distribute them to hundreds or thousands of publishers. The articles then appear online targeted to specific audiences. Article marketing enables affiliate marketers to target a different demographic with every article written.
Hiring writers to write articles allows marketers more time to advertise using other means. They simply advise writers that they would like to target a different demographic with specific keywords. No article is ever published without the consent of the marketer.
Article topics and keywords are used at the discretion of the affiliate marketer. Articles always need be written in a persuasive voice that entices the reader to click the link to visit the affiliates landing page. The primary objective is to pre-sell a product or service by providing quality information.
